Ingredients You’ll Need
One of the best things about Cosmic Brownies is how they rely on straightforward ingredients to deliver layers of flavor, texture, and irresistible visual appeal. Each component plays a role in creating the brownies’ signature dense, chewy bite and show-stopping top.
- Melted unsalted butter: Adds richness and gives the brownies a super moist, dense crumb.
- Granulated sugar: Brings sweetness and helps the brownies set with that classic, slightly crackly top.
- Light brown sugar: Infuses a bit of caramel-like depth and boosts chewiness.
- Large eggs: Bind everything together and provide structure and fudginess.
- Vanilla extract: Enhances the chocolate flavor—don’t skip this little bit of liquid gold!
- All-purpose flour: Keeps the brownies thick and sturdy without making them cakey.
- Unsweetened cocoa powder: Gives an intensely chocolatey base without extra sweetness.
- Salt: Balances out all that chocolate richness and brightens the flavor.
- Heavy cream: Makes the ganache luscious and silky-smooth.
- Semisweet chocolate chips: Melt down into a glossy ganache—quality matters for the best flavor here.
- Rainbow candy-coated chocolate chips (or rainbow sprinkles): The ultimate finishing touch for that signature Cosmic Brownies look and a pop of fun in every bite!
How to Make Cosmic Brownies
Step 1: Prep Your Pan and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a 9×13-inch baking pan with parchment paper, making sure to leave a little overhang on the sides for easy brownie removal later. This simple step is key for perfect, clean bars—no sticking, no crumbling, and a breeze to slice.
Step 2: Mix the Brownie Batter
In a large bowl, combine your melted but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ar. Whisk until smooth and glossy—this is what makes for that ultimate fudge factor! Next, add the eggs and vanilla extract. Whisk again until everything’s fully blended. Sift in the flour, unsweetened cocoa powder, and salt. Now, switch to a spatula or wooden spoon and stir gently, just until there are no more streaks of flour. Overmixing is the enemy of fudgy brownies, so fold with care.
Step 3: Bake to Fudgy Perfection
Pour your luscious batter into the prepared pan and spread it evenly to all corners with an offset spatula or the back of a spoon. Bake for 22 to 25 minutes—keep an eye out for when the center is just set, with the tiniest wobble. That’s your cue for ultra-fudgy Cosmic Brownies! Let them cool completely right in the pan so they firm up and are easy to slice later.
Step 4: Make the Silky Ganache
While the brownies cool, it’s ganache time! Heat the heavy cream in a small saucepan over medium heat, stopping when it just starts to simmer—no need to boil. Pour the hot cream over the semisweet chocolate chips in a heatproof bowl and let it rest for a couple of minutes, then stir until you get a beautifully smooth, glossy ganache. This layer is pure chocolate bliss!
Step 5: Assemble and Chill Your Cosmic Brownies
Once the brownies are fully cool, gently spread the ganache over the top, going all the way to the edges. No need to be too precious—swirls and swoops are welcome! Right away, shower with rainbow candy-coated chips or sprinkles for that unmistakable Cosmic Brownies magic. Pop the pan into the refrigerator and chill for at least an hour so everything sets up blissfully firm and sliceable.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Your Cosmic Brownies will keep their fudgy bite and delightful crunch from the candy chips for several days if stored properly. Place them in an airtight container, layering parchment or wax paper between layers to prevent sticking, and store at room temperature for up to three days or in the fridge for up to a week.
Freezing
If you want to save some Cosmic Brownies for a future treat, these freeze beautifully! Wrap individual brownies tightly in plastic wrap, then pop them in a freezer bag or airtight container. They’ll stay fresh for up to three months—just thaw overnight in the refrigerator before serving (though a few minutes at room temp works in a pinch).
Reheating
If you crave that just-baked aroma and texture, reheat your brownies briefly. A quick 10–15 seconds in the microwave will soften the ganache and make the brownie extra gooey. For a more oven-fresh effect, place a brownie square on a baking sheet in a 300°F oven for about five minutes. Just keep an eye on the toppings—they’ll melt if overheated!
FAQs
Can I use dutch-process cocoa instead of unsweetened cocoa powder?
Absolutely! Dutch-process cocoa will give the brownies an even deeper chocolate flavor and a slightly darker color. Just be sure to use unsweetened, as the recipe’s sugar content is already balanced for a bittersweet, fudgy treat.
How can I tell if Cosmic Brownies are done baking?
Look for the center to be just set—slightly firm, but still with a bit of give if you gently shake the pan. A toothpick inserted near the center should come out with a few moist crumbs, not totally clean. This ensures the brownies stay moist and fudgy as they cool.
Can I make the ganache 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the ganache up to a day in advance. Store it covered at room temperature if you’re using it within a few hours, or in the fridge if you’re making it further ahead. Let it sit out to come to spreading consistency before topping the brownies.
Can I make Cosmic Brownies gluten-free?
Definitely! Swap the all-purpose flour for a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end. Just check that all your other mix-ins (especially sprinkles) are certified gluten-free for those with sensitivities.
What’s the best way to slice Cosmic Brownies cleanly?
Chill the brownies well, then use a sharp knife dipped in hot water and wiped dry between cuts. This helps you get those bakery-style squares with crisp edges and keeps the ganache looking gorgeous.

Cosmic Brownies Recipe
- Total Time: 1 hour 40 minutes
- Yield: 16 brownies 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Indulge in the cosmic delight of these fudgy homemade Cosmic Brownies topped with a decadent chocolate ganache and colorful rainbow candy-coated chips. Perfect for satisfying your sweet tooth!
Ingredients
Brownies:
- 1 cup unsalted butter (melted)
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 cup packed light brown sugar
- 4 large eggs
- 1 tablespo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
Ganache:
- ¾ cup heavy cream
- 1 ½ cups semisweet chocolate chips
Topping:
- ½ cup rainbow candy-coated chocolate chips (or rainbow sprinkles)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ven: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a 9×13-inch baking pan with parchment paper.
- Mix the Brownie Batter: Whisk together melted but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ar. Add eggs, vanilla, sift in flour, cocoa powder, and salt. Mix until just combined.
- Bake: Pour batter into the pan and bake for 22–25 minutes until set. Let cool.
- Prepare Ganache: Heat cream, pour over chocolate chips, let sit, then stir until smooth.
- Assemble: Spread ganache over cooled brownies, top with rainbow chips/sprinkles. Chill before slicing.
Notes
- For fudgier brownies, underbake slightly and chill overnight.
- You can use chopped M&M’s if rainbow candy chips are not available.
